Well said, Massimo. We narrow the gene pool far too much if we avoid using dogs because of a 'bad' result. People have been saying that an N/DM + N/DM breeding will produce 50% affected dogs. Surely, statistically, it would be 25% affected, 50% carrier and 25% free? So by avoiding these breedings, we deny the existance of healthy pups who can carry on the diversity of the gene pool.
